Local tips

  • Arrive early in the morning to enjoy the pools before they get crowded.
  • Bring along a picnic to enjoy in the serene surroundings.
  • Ensure you are a competent swimmer, as some areas can be deep.
  • Wear water shoes for better grip on the rocky surfaces around the pools.
  • Respect the natural environment by cleaning up after your visit.

Discover more about Three Pools

Nestled in the heart of Blanchisseuse, Trinidad, the Three Pools is a mesmerizing natural attraction that offers visitors a unique blend of adventure and serenity. This picturesque spot is characterized by its crystal-clear, turquoise waters that cascade into a series of tranquil pools, surrounded by lush greenery and vibrant tropical flora. Ideal for those looking to escape the hustle and bustle of urban life, the Three Pools invites tourists to immerse themselves in the beauty of nature. Whether you're an avid swimmer or simply seeking a peaceful place to unwind, this location caters to all. The sound of the gentle water flow and the soft rustle of leaves provide a soothing backdrop, making it a perfect spot for relaxation and meditation. Visitors should note that swimming is a must to truly appreciate the stunning surroundings; however, it's essential to be a competent swimmer to navigate the varying depths of the pools safely. The experience is further enriched by the breathtaking views of the surrounding landscape, which offers ample opportunities for photography and appreciation of the natural beauty of Trinidad. Given its allure, the Three Pools is a popular destination, so arriving early in the day is advisable to avoid crowds. Don't forget to bring along a picnic to enhance your visit, allowing you to savor a meal in this tranquil paradise. The Three Pools is more than just a tourist attraction; it embodies the essence of Trinidad's natural beauty and serves as a reminder of the importance of preserving such pristine environments for future generations.
